Antonella Gambale Roberta Russo Immacolata Andolfo Lucia Quaglietta Gianluca De Rosa Valentina Contestabile Lucia De Martino Rita Genesio Piero Pignataro Sabrina Giglio Mario Capasso Rosanna Parasole Barbara Pasini Achille Iolascon 《Clinical genetics》2019,96(4):359-365
Cancer predisposition syndromes (CPS) result from germline pathogenic variants, and they are increasingly recognized in the etiology of many pediatric cancers. Herein, we report the genetic/genomic analysis of 40 pediatric patients enrolled from 2016 to 2018. Our diagnostic workflow was successful in 50% of screened cases. Overall, the proportion of CPS in our case series is 10.9% (20/184) of enrolled patients. Interestingly, 12.5% of patients achieved a conclusive diagnosis through the analysis of chromosomal imbalance. Indeed, we observed germline microdeletions/duplications of regions encompassing cancer-related genes in 50% of patients undergoing array-CGH: EIF3H duplication in a patient with infantile desmoplastic astrocytoma and low-grade Glioma; SLFN11 deletion, SOX4 duplication, and PARK2 partial deletion in three neuroblastoma patients; a PTPRD partial deletion in a child diagnosed with glioblastoma multiforme. Finally, we identified two cases due to DICER1 germline mutations. 相似文献

Idiopathic CD4+ lymphocytopenia may be due to decreased bone marrow clonogenic capability 总被引:1,自引:0,他引:1
Isgrò A Sirianni MC Gramiccioni C Mezzaroma I Fantauzzi A Aiuti F 《International archives of allergy and immunology》2005,136(4):379-384
BACKGROUND: Idiopathic CD4+ lymphocytopenia is defined by a stable decrease of CD4+ T cells in the absence of any known cause of immune deficiency. The mechanisms responsible for the immunological impairment are still unknown, but a regenerative failure of hematopoietic stem/progenitor cells has been hypothesized. METHODS: We evaluated in the bone marrow (BM) of 5 patients with idiopathic CD4+ lymphocytopenia the phenotype of BM progenitor cells, their differentiation capacity with colony-forming cells and long-term culture-initiating cell assays, in parallel with the spontaneous IL-7 production in the patient sera. RESULTS: Compared with controls, a regenerative failure of hematopoietic stem cells has been observed, both in 'committed' and in 'uncommitted' progenitor cells, despite high IL-7 serum levels. The percentage of phenotypically primitive CD34+CD38-DR+ cells (this includes the lymphoid precursor cells) was decreased, suggesting an involvement of the more primitive BM compartment in the de novo T cell generation. CONCLUSIONS: Despite the low number of patients, due to the low incidence of the disease, the decrease of primitive precursors sustains the possibility that diminished stem cell precursors might contribute to the development of CD4+ T cell depletion. 相似文献

Tuccillo C Cuomo A Rocco A Martinelli E Staibano S Mascolo M Gravina AG Nardone G Ricci V Ciardiello F Del Vecchio Blanco C Romano M 《The Journal of pathology》2005,207(3):277-284
Host response plays a major role in the pathogenesis of Helicobacter pylori-induced gastroduodenal disease including adenocarcinoma of the distal stomach. Vascular endothelial growth factor (VEGF) is an important modulator of gastric mucosal repair and is overexpressed in gastric cancer. The present study sought to evaluate the expression of VEGF in the gastric mucosa of H. pylori-infected and H. pylori-non-infected dyspeptic patients. Fifteen H. pylori-infected and 15 H. pylori-non-infected dyspeptic patients were studied. Diagnosis of H. pylori infection was based on rapid urease test and histology. VEGF protein expression was assessed by western blotting. VEGF mRNA expression was assessed by RT-PCR. VEGF localization in the gastric mucosa and neo-angiogenesis were determined by immunohistochemistry. VEGF protein and mRNA expression was significantly greater in H. pylori-infected than in non-infected patients. Immunohistochemistry showed that VEGF expression was more intense in the gastric gland compartment of H. pylori-infected mucosa than in the non-infected mucosa. The increase in VEGF expression was associated with a significant increase in neo-angiogenesis as assessed by determination of CD34-positive micro-vessels. H. pylori gastritis is therefore associated with up-regulation of VEGF expression, which parallels the increased formation of blood vessels in the gastric mucosa. It is postulated that increased VEGF expression and neo-angiogenesis may contribute to H. pylori-related gastric carcinogenesis. 相似文献

Antonella Cianferoni Elio Novembre Neri Pucci Enrico Lombardi Roberto Bernardini Alberto Vierucci 《Annals of allergy, asthma & immunology》2004,92(4):464-468
BACKGROUND: Little is known about the frequency of and the features associated with recurrent anaphylaxis in pediatric populations. During 1994 to 1996, we enrolled 76 children affected by anaphylaxis in a prospective study to analyze their clinical and allergic features. OBJECTIVE: To undertake a follow-up study of these children to ascertain how many experienced a recurrence of anaphylaxis. METHODS: After a mean interval of 7 years, a pediatric allergist conducted a telephone interview of patients who had been enrolled in our 1994-1996 study. RESULTS: A telephone interview was successfully completed in 46 (61%) of the 76 patients who had been enrolled in our 1994-1996 study. Of these 46 patients, 14 (30%) had experienced a recurrence of anaphylaxis. Children with atopic dermatitis either during 1994 to 1996 (64% vs 34%; P = .04) or at the time of the current study (43% vs 16%; P = .03) and those with urticaria-angioedema at the time of the current study (93% vs 31%; P = .0002) were found to be at a significantly higher risk for recurrent anaphylaxis. Furthermore, those children who were sensitive to at least 1 food allergen during 1994 to 1996 were more likely to have experienced a recurrence of anaphylaxis (93% vs 56%; P < .04). CONCLUSIONS: This study suggests that patients may have a greater risk of recurrence of anaphylaxis if they have atopic dermatitis, urticaria-angioedema, or at least 1 positive result of skin prick tests to food allergens. 相似文献

Zei G Lisa A Fiorani O Magri C Quintana-Murci L Semino O Santachiara-Benerecetti AS 《European journal of human genetics : EJHG》2003,11(10):802-807
A total of 202 Sardinian male subjects were examined for 13 biallelic stable markers, the complex 49a,f/TaqI system and three microsatellites of the Y chromosome in order to investigate, through surname analysis, on a possible territorial heterogeneity inside the island. The study of geographical distribution and linguistic derivation of Sardinian surnames allow us to discover their 'probable place of origin' and reconstruct ancient genetic isolates which borders are, today, no more recognizable. The molecular analysis revealed that about 90% of the Sardinian Y chromosomes fell into haplogroups E-M35, G-M201, I-M26, J-12f2 and R-M269. In contrast with the territorial homogeneity of these haplogroups, when the individuals were distributed according to their birthplace, a significant difference between the three historically and culturally distinct geographical areas into which Sardinia can be subdivided was observed when the individuals were distributed according to the ancestral location of surnames. In particular, the major contribution to this heterogeneity is due to the 'Sardinian-specific' haplogroup I-M26 (almost completely associated with the 49a,f-Ht12/12f2-10Kb/YCAIIa-21/YCAIIb-11 compound haplotype), which shows both a significantly higher incidence in the central-eastern (archaic) area and a significantly lower frequency in the northern area. The results of this study agree with the hypothesis that the ancestral homeland of this specific subset of haplogroup I is the mountainous central-eastern area of Sardinia, where the population underwent a long history of isolation since ancient times, and highlight the informative power of the surname analysis. 相似文献

Johann Kaspar Lieberwirth Pascal Joset Anja Heinze Julia Hentschel Anja Stein Antonella Iannaccone Katharina Steindl Alma Kuechler Rami Abou Jamra 《European journal of human genetics : EJHG》2021,29(5):808
Perinatal mortality is a heavy burden for both affected parents and physicians. However, the underlying genetic causes have not been sufficiently investigated and most cases remain without diagnosis. This impedes appropriate counseling or therapy. We describe four affected children of two unrelated families with cardiomyopathy, hydrops fetalis, or cystic hygroma that all deceased perinatally. In the four patients, we found the following homozygous loss of function (LoF) variants in SLC30A5 NM_022902.4:c.832_836del p.(Ile278Phefs*33) and NM_022902.4:c.1981_1982del p.(His661Tyrfs*10). Knockout of SLC30A5 has previously been shown a cardiac phenotype in mouse models and no homozygous LoF variants in SLC30A5 are currently described in gnomAD. Taken together, we present SLC30A5 as a new gene for a severe and perinatally lethal form of cardiomyopathy.Subject terms: Cardiovascular diseases, Development, Medical genetics, Medical genomics 相似文献

Evaluation of the E Test for Antimicrobial Susceptibility Testing of Pseudomonas aeruginosa Isolates from Patients with Long-Term Bladder Catheterization 下载免费PDF全文
Giovanni Di Bonaventura Evandro Ricci Nicoletta Della Loggia Giovanni Catamo Raffaele Piccolomini 《Journal of clinical microbiology》1998,36(3):824-826
The E test was evaluated in comparison with reference agar methods (National Committee for Clinical Laboratory Standards) for the susceptibility testing of 248 Pseudomonas aeruginosa isolates from bladder-catheterized patients against nine antibiotics. The E-test MICs correlated well with those determined by the agar dilution and disk diffusion reference methods (88 and 92.5% within 1 log2 dilution step, respectively), confirming that the E test is a reliable method for the determination of MICs of antibiotics for catheterization-associated P. aeruginosa isolates. 相似文献

Amenta F Mignini F Ricci A Sabbatini M Tomassoni D Tayebati SK 《Mechanisms of ageing and development》2001,122(16):2071-2083
Hippocampus is a brain region involved in learning and memory and is particularly sensitive to ageing. It is supplied with a dopaminergic innervation arising from the midbrain, which is part of the mesolimbic dopaminergic pathway. Dysfunction of the dopaminergic mesolimbic system is probably involved in the pathophysiology of psychosis and behavioural disturbances occurring in the elderly. The present study was designed to assess the density and localisation of dopamine D1- and D2-like receptor subtypes in the hippocampus of male Sprague-Dawley rats aged 3 months (young), 12 months (adult) and 24 months (old). Dopamine D1-like receptors, labelled by [3H]-SCH 23390, in young rats displayed a dentate gyrus-CA1 subfield gradient. The expression was increased in the cell body of dentate gyrus, CA4 and CA3 subfield of old rats compared to younger cohorts, as well as in the neuropil of dentate gyrus. A decreased density of dopamine D1-like receptors was found in the stratum oriens of CA1 and CA3 subfields. Dopamine D2-like receptors, labelled using [3H]-spiperone as radioligand, were expressed rather homogeneously throughout different subfields of the hippocampus. In old rats, the density of dopamine D2-like receptors was decreased in the dentate gyrus, unchanged in the CA4 and CA1 subfields and increased in the CA3 subfield. The above results indicate the occurrence of inhomogeneous changes in the density of dopamine D1- and D2-like receptors in specific portions of hippocampus of old rats. These findings support the hypothesis of an involvement of dopaminergic system in behavioural abnormalities or psychosis occurring in ageing. 相似文献

Trisomy 8 in myelodysplasia and acute leukemia is constitutional in 15-20% of cases. 总被引:2,自引:0,他引:2
Emanuela Maserati Fiorenza Aprili Fabrizio Vinante Franco Locatelli Giovanni Amendola Adriana Zatterale Giuseppe Milone Antonella Minelli Franca Bernardi Francesco Lo Curto Francesco Pasquali 《Genes, chromosomes & cancer》2002,33(1):93-97
The trisomy 8 found in malignancies may derive from a constitutional trisomy 8 mosaicism (CT8M), and in these cases the trisomy itself may be regarded as the first mutation in a multistep carcinogenetic process. To assess the frequency of CT8M in hematological dysplastic and neoplastic disorders with trisomy 8, an informative sample of 14 patients was collected. The data ascertained included chromosome analyses of fibroblast cultures and of PHA-stimulated blood cultures in patients with normal blood differential count, as well as possible CT8M clinical signs. One patient showed trisomy 8 in all cell types analyzed and undoubtedly has a CT8M; a second patient consistently showed trisomy 8 in PHA-stimulated blood cultures when no immature myeloid cells were present in blood and should be considered as having CT8M; a third patient, with Philadelphia-positive chronic myelocytic leukemia, was more difficult to interpret, but the possibility that she had CT8M is likely. A few clinical signs of CT8M were also present in these three patients. Our data indicate that the frequency of CT8M in hematological dysplastic and neoplastic disorders with trisomy 8 is approximately 15-20%. 相似文献
